Factors Affecting Cost
- Distance of Relocation: Longer distances generally require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Complexity of the Project: Projects involving obstacles like walls or floors can be more challenging and expensive.
- Type of Gas Line: Different materials (e.g., steel, copper, or flexible gas lines) have varying cost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ations in Oxnard may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Labor Rates: Labor costs can fluctuate based on the expertise required and the local market rates in Oxnard.
- Time of Year: Seasonal demand can impact availability and pricing of contractors.
- Additional Safety Measures: Extra safety precautions or equipment may be needed, affecting the total expense.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task Description | Average Cost Range |
---|---|
Initial Consultation and Planning | $100 - $200 |
Permit Fees | $50 - $150 |
Basic Gas Line Relocation | $500 - $1,000 |
Complex Gas Line Relocation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Pressure Testing and Inspection | $100 - $300 |
Additional Safety Equipment | $50 - $200 |
